An approach to the study of the fungal deterioration of a classical art material: Mastic varnish Electron. J. Biotechnol.
Romero-Noguera,Julio; López-Miras,María del Mar; Martín-Sánchez,Inés; Ramos-López,José Miguel; Bolívar-Galiano,Fernando.
Mastic, one of the best natural varnishes, is frequently used as protective and finishing layer or as component of oleo-resinous media in paintings, both in the past and currently. However, this resin is affected by complex deterioration processes which can change its characteristics and thus the visual aspect of works of art. The alteration processes caused by radiation have been widely studied, but there is a lack of information on the biodeterioration of this natural product. In this paper, fungi from collections as well as from oil paintings of the Fine Arts Museum of Granada (Spain) were inoculated onto slides covered with mastic. Biodeterioration patterns found in dammar resin used as art material Electron. J. Biotechnol.
Romero-Noguera,Julio; Martín-Sánchez,Inés; López-Miras,María del Mar; Ramos-López,José Miguel; Bolívar-Galiano,Fernando.
Since the middle of the XIX century, when dammar became popular in Occident, this natural resin is one of the most used in art painting techniques as final protective coating (varnish) as well as a component of pictorial media. The present work is the first approach to the study of the microbiological biodeterioration of this artistic material, which can seriously affect the appearance and integrity of works of art when bad conservation conditions -especially high humidity levels- take place. 12 microorganisms, fungi and bacteria, came from collection and from oil paintings affected by biodeterioration patterns, were inoculated on test specimens prepared with varnish dammar.
